Current Transducer LAS 100-TP
For the electronic measurement of currents : DC, AC, pulsed, mixed,
with a galvanic isolation between the primary circuit (high power)
and the secondary circuit (electronic circuit).

Features
Current transducer using
Eta-technology
Unipolar voltage supply
Insulated plastic case recognized
according to UL 94-V0
Compact design for PCB mounting
Extended measuring range.
Advantages
Excellent accuracy
Very good linearity
Very low temperature drift
Optimized response time
Wide frequency bandwidth
No insertion losses
High immunity to external
interference
Current overload capability.
Applications
AC variable speed drives and servo
motor drives
Static converters for DC motor drives
Battery supplied applications
Uninterruptible Power Supplies (UPS)
Switched Mode Power Supplies (SMPS)
Power supplies for welding
applications.
Application domain
Industrial.
